PGTBushmaster ACR Enhanced in Coyote Brown
I've wanted one of these for a bit but the last of "new" production my LGS had from the Remy bankruptcy auction were higher than I cared to spend and lacked the matching sights. I found this one on one of the forums and made a deal for it. It is the "Enhanced" model with quad rail and folding stock.
I was able to find new/old stock parts at MGW and ordered two handguards, the fixed stock shown in these pics and a spare lower module. It's pretty interesting to see the thinking here....AR18 operating design and truly modular. No tools are needed to swap configs around including barrel/caliber changes.
Franklin Armory bought the rights to the platform (and Bushmaster) out of the fire sale and is said to be working on re-releasing the ACR (and hopefully spares and caliber kits).
I ordered a Midwest Industries MLOK handguard for it as well. I prefer the handguard shown in the pics but no idea how long parts will be offered and it's the matching FDE/Field Drab so that saves me a step.
On to pics...I'll be taking it to the range on Monday for the annual private MG shoot a friend holds down south in VA. I'll bring this and my FN FNC with a Butler Creek electronic magloader (which works great).
and with the "Enhanced" parts. Interestingly, the handguard mounts in the same way as the Sig MCX - slide overs the monolithic receiver and secures with a single pin
